Transaction ebecc5fb16b6d7003f740f879fc709243fda8fddc188e8b5172389ad3d0729f6
1 Input
1 Output
-
ebecc5fb16b6d7003f740f879fc709243fda8fddc188e8b5172389ad3d0729f6:0
- value
- 338716
- script pubkey
- OP_0 OP_PUSHBYTES_20 393c897cb34bd4febc2ac38989adc0875214c98d
- address
- bc1q8y7gjl9nf020a0p2cwycntwqsafpfjvdulcj2x